选择阿里云RDS(关系型数据库服务)的配置时,需根据实际业务需求(如访问量、数据量、性能要求、高可用性、预算等)综合评估。以下是常见的推荐配置建议,适用于不同规模的应用场景:
一、通用推荐配置(以 MySQL 为例)
| 场景 | 推荐配置 | 说明 |
|---|---|---|
| 小型应用 / 个人项目 / 测试环境 | – 类型:通用型 – CPU:2核 – 内存:4GB – 存储:40GB~100GB(SSD) – 网络:按量或固定带宽5Mbps |
适合低并发、小数据量的博客、小程序、测试环境等。 |
| 中型应用 / 中小型企业网站 / 初创项目 | – 类型:独享型(推荐) – CPU:4核 – 内存:8GB – 存储:100GB~500GB(ESSD或SSD) – 网络:5~10Mbps |
支持日活几千~几万用户,支持一定并发读写。建议开启只读实例分担查询压力。 |
| 大型应用 / 高并发业务 / 电商 / SaaS平台 | – 类型:独享型 或 三节点企业版 – CPU:8核 ~ 16核 – 内存:16GB ~ 32GB – 存储:500GB~2TB(ESSD PL1 或更高) – 网络:10Mbps以上 |
建议开启只读实例 + 高可用架构(多可用区部署),保障性能与稳定性。 |
| 关键业务 / X_X级高可用需求 | – 类型:三节点企业版 或 集群版 – CPU:16核以上 – 内存:32GB以上 – 存储:ESSD PL2/PL3,2TB+ – 多可用区部署 |
强一致性、故障秒级切换,适合对数据安全和可用性要求极高的场景。 |
二、关键配置建议
-
实例类型选择
- 通用型:性价比高,适合轻负载,但计算和内存资源与其他服务共享。
- 独享型:资源独占,性能稳定,生产环境推荐使用。
- 三节点企业版:X_X级高可用,数据三副本,适合关键业务。
-
存储类型
- ESSD云盘(推荐):性能可选(PL1/PL2/PL3),IOPS 和吞吐量更高,适合高并发。
- SSD云盘:性价比适中,适用于大多数场景。
- 存储空间建议预留 30%~50% 增长空间。
-
数据库版本
- 推荐使用 MySQL 8.0(性能更好、功能更全)或 MySQL 5.7(兼容性好)。
- 如需JSON、窗口函数等新特性,优先选 8.0。
-
高可用架构
- 生产环境务必选择 高可用版(主备架构,跨可用区部署)。
- 自动故障切换,RPO=0,RTO<60秒。
-
只读实例
- 读多写少的场景(如报表、数据分析),建议添加 1~2 个只读实例,分担主库压力。
-
备份与安全
- 开启自动备份(建议保留7天以上)。
- 启用日志备份(用于时间点恢复)。
- 使用VPC网络隔离,设置白名单和SSL加密。
三、成本优化建议
- 包年包月 vs 按量付费:
- 长期稳定使用 → 包年包月更便宜(可节省30%~50%)。
- 临时测试 → 按量付费更灵活。
- 存储自动扩容:开启后可避免因空间不足导致服务中断。
- 监控与告警:使用云监控关注CPU、连接数、IOPS等指标,及时扩容。
四、示例配置(MySQL 8.0,华东1区)
| 规格 | 实例类型 | CPU/内存 | 存储 | 价格参考(月付) |
|---|---|---|---|---|
| mysql.x4.large | 独享型 | 2核4GB | 100GB SSD | ≈ 600元 |
| mysql.x4.xlarge | 独享型 | 4核8GB | 200GB SSD | ≈ 1200元 |
| mysql.x4.2xlarge | 独享型 | 8核16GB | 500GB ESSD | ≈ 2500元 |
| mysql.x8.4xlarge | 三节点企业版 | 16核32GB | 1TB ESSD PL1 | ≈ 6000元 |
⚠️ 价格随地域、活动变化,建议登录 阿里云官网RDS页面 实时查询。
五、总结建议
- 起步阶段:选择 独享型 4核8GB + 200GB SSD,性价比高,易于扩展。
- 生产环境:必须使用 高可用版 + 多可用区 + 自动备份。
- 高并发/关键业务:考虑 三节点企业版 + ESSD + 只读实例。
如提供具体业务场景(如日均PV、数据量、QPS、是否读写分离等),可进一步定制推荐配置。
CLOUD云枢